Carlton has a strong mix of Victorian terraces, 1930s semis and post-war family homes, and most of them share the same problem: a cramped kitchen at the back and one bathroom for the whole household. A double storey rear extension solves both in a single project. Downstairs you gain an open-plan kitchen-diner opening onto the garden; upstairs you add a bedroom, a family bathroom or a main bedroom with en-suite.
Because the second storey sits on the same foundations, roof and scaffolding as the first, the cost per square metre is noticeably lower than building two separate single storey projects. For growing families around Carlton Hill, Standhill and towards Gedling, it is often better value than moving house once stamp duty and fees are counted.

Double Storey Rear Extension Costs in Carlton
Guide prices for 2026. Every project is priced individually after a free survey.
| Project Size | Typical Footprint | Guide Price | Typical Duration |
|---|---|---|---|
| Compact double storey | 3m x 4m per floor | £70,000 – £95,000 | 14-18 weeks |
| Mid-size double storey | 4m x 5m per floor | £95,000 – £130,000 | 16-22 weeks |
| Large double storey | 5m x 6m per floor | £130,000 – £175,000+ | 20-26 weeks |
📋 Guide prices include the structural build, standard fit-out and Building Regulations sign-off. Kitchens, bathrooms and premium finishes vary by specification – we itemise everything in your written quote.
Planning Permission for Double Storey Rear Extensions
What Gedling Borough Council Looks For
- Permitted development allows a double storey rear extension up to 3m deep on many houses, but strict conditions apply – most Carlton projects go through a full planning application instead.
- The extension must sit at least 7m from the rear boundary and match the materials of the existing house.
- Upstairs side-facing windows normally need obscure glazing to protect neighbours’ privacy.
- The 45-degree rule is used to check your extension does not overshadow next door’s main windows.
- Semi-detached and terraced homes usually need Party Wall agreements with adjoining neighbours – we arrange these for you.

Double Storey Rear Extension FAQs – Carlton
In most cases, yes. Permitted development only covers double storey rear extensions up to 3m deep with strict height and boundary rules, so the majority of Carlton projects go through a full application to Gedling Borough Council. We prepare and manage the whole application for you.
Most Carlton projects fall between £70,000 and £130,000 depending on size and finish, with larger builds reaching £175,000 or more. You receive a fixed itemised quote after a free survey, so there are no surprises.
On site, expect 14 to 26 weeks depending on size and specification. Add around 8 weeks beforehand for the planning decision from Gedling Borough Council, plus design time. We give you a full programme before work starts.
Yes, most Carlton families stay at home throughout. We build the shell and make it weathertight before knocking through, which keeps dust and disruption to a short, planned window near the end of the project.
If you live in a semi or terrace, or your foundations sit within 3m of a neighbour’s structure, then yes. We serve the notices, talk to your neighbours and arrange a surveyor if one is needed, so the process stays friendly and on schedule.
